    AFM:  I had my sonohysterogram last week. All looks good in the ute! While I was there I talked with my RE regarding concerns I have. No one has been able to tell me the "Why" I have DOR at such a young age.  Could this be autoimmune?  Everything else I have tested to help figure out the why has been normal (Karyotype, neg for fragile x, etc.)  My concern was/is if the cause is autoimmune be more likely to miscarry? She said the why matters in relation to long term health, but it will not increase my risk for miscarriage.  So she sent me to have labs drawn to see if I have anti-ovarian, anti-adrenal and anti-thyroid antibodies in order to give me answers and possibly prevent/manage future health problems associated with autoimmune disease.

  • Hi ladies, GL to everyone cycling and (((hugs))) all around, looks like there's quite a few going through some rough patches.

    Update: Still the same, I will probably call today to set up an appt for another blood drawn for the week of 12/2. That will be 12 weeks from my first positive blood test for Lupus Anticoagulant, and they require 2 tests 12 weeks apart to confirm it. If it's positive, then I will make an appt with a hematologist, and proceed probably with cycling using Lovenox. If it's negative, then we will still probably cycle, but have no answers for why I keep miscarrying.
